2. Potential Advantages of Specialized Instructions like "1120 m-3 Instructions"



Specialized instructions, like the hypothetical "1120 m-3 instructions," can offer significant advantages in specific application domains. These advantages often stem from:

Performance Gains: Optimized instructions can directly translate high-level operations into efficient hardware operations, bypassing the need for multiple simpler instructions. This can lead to substantial performance improvements, particularly in computationally intensive tasks. For example, if the "1120 m-3 instructions" are designed for matrix multiplication, they could drastically speed up machine learning algorithms.

Power Efficiency: Specialized instructions can minimize the number of clock cycles and data transfers required for a given task, directly contributing to reduced power consumption. This is particularly important in mobile and embedded systems where power efficiency is a critical design constraint. The efficiency of "1120 m-3 instructions" would depend on their implementation and the overall ISA design.

Code Density: Well-designed specialized instructions can lead to smaller code sizes, reducing memory requirements and potentially improving cache performance. This benefit is particularly crucial in resource-constrained environments like embedded systems. The compactness of code resulting from the effective use of "1120 m-3 instructions" needs to be carefully evaluated.


3. Challenges and Disadvantages of Implementing "1120 m-3 Instructions"



Despite the potential advantages, implementing specialized instructions like "1120 m-3 instructions" comes with its own set of challenges:

Compiler Optimization: Compilers need to be specifically adapted to effectively utilize specialized instructions. Failure to do so can negate the performance and power benefits. The complexity of compiler optimization for "1120 m-3 instructions" would depend heavily on the instruction's functionality and interaction with other instructions.

Hardware Complexity: Implementing specialized instructions may require additional hardware resources, increasing the cost and complexity of the processor. The design trade-off between performance benefits and added hardware complexity needs to be thoroughly evaluated for "1120 m-3 instructions."

Portability and Backward Compatibility: Specialized instructions can limit the portability of software across different architectures. Backward compatibility with existing codebases can also be a challenge, potentially requiring significant software rewriting or emulation.
